Ge-incorporation into 6-line ferrihydritenanocrystals

Abstract

A Ge-incorporated ‘6-lineferrihydrite with 20% of total Fe3+ sites occupied by Ge4+ was synthesized for the first time through hydrolysis and acidification of the mixed solution of Fe(NO3)3·9H2O and TEOGe (Ge(OC2H5)4). The newly synthesized Ge-ferrihydrite shows a monodisperse nanocrystalline structure with diameters of ∼10 and ∼40 nm with distinctly enhanced crystallinity and stability.
